What Should I Look For when Choosing an Area Rug?

Since the right area rug can have such a large influence on the way your room looks and feels, you can imagine that the wrong area rug can have the same effect on the space. This is why you want to take several things into consideration when choosing the right rug for your room. Here are some starting points:
– Area Rug Color: This is a natural place to start. You will have certain colors you are working with in your room. You can easily make a statement with color when you incorporate it in you rug. This can be a place you can be bolder and get away with it. If you aren’t looking to make a statement with your rug, you can keep the colors neutral as well. When choosing the color, decide if you want your rug to blend in or stand out in the space.
– Area Rug Pattern: If you have a lot of patterns in the space your styling, you may want to stick with a solid-colored area rug. However, if you don’t, choosing a rug that has patterns woven into it can be a beautiful addition to your room. If the area rug is the first thing you are choosing for the space, you can choose whatever you want, but if it isn’t, take into consideration the furniture and other pieces in the room.
– Area Rug Size: This is a big one. You need to make sure you aren’t choosing a rug that is the wrong size for your space. Choosing an undersized rug can leave the rug looking ridiculous. If you have furniture in the room, you want to have at least the front legs of the furniture resting on the rug. For most rooms, a good rule of thumb is to have only 10-24 inches of bare floor between the edge of the rug and the walls in the room.
– Area Rug Maintenance: Some rugs require more maintenance than others will. Take this into consideration when you are choosing your rug. If you aren’t up to caring for a high maintenance rug, be honest with yourself and avoid buying them.
